What does an information assurance engineer at Accenture do?

An Information Assurance Engineer at Accenture is responsible for ensuring the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of information systems. They assess security risks, develop and implement security measures, and monitor systems for vulnerabilities or breaches. These professionals also work with clients to ensure compliance with industry standards and regulations, provide recommendations for improvement, and support incident response activities. Their work helps organizations protect sensitive data and maintain trust in their IT infrastructure.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an information assurance engineer at Accenture?

To thrive as an Information Assurance Engineer at Accenture, you need a solid understanding of cybersecurity principles, risk management frameworks, and relevant compliance standards, typically sup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with tools like SIEM platforms, vulnerability assessment tools, and certifications such as CISSP or Security+ are highly valued. Strong analytical thinking, effective communication, and problem-solving skills set professionals apart in this role. These competencies are crucial for protecting sensitive data, ensuring regulatory compliance, and proactively addressing security threats in dynamic enterprise environments.

What is the difference between Information Assurance Engineer Accenture vs Cybersecurity Analyst?

AspectInformation Assurance Engineer AccentureCybersecurity Analyst
CertificationsCompTIA Security+, CISSP, CEHCompTIA Security+, CISSP, CEH
Work EnvironmentConsulting firm, client sites, corporate officesCorporate security teams, IT departments, security operations centers
Industry UsageUsed across consulting, government, and private sectorsPrimarily in corporate and government cybersecurity teams
Job FocusEnsuring information systems' security, compliance, and risk managementMonitoring, analyzing, and responding to security threats

Both roles require similar certifications and work in security-focused environments, but the Information Assurance Engineer Accenture typically works within consulting projects and client environments, focusing on compliance and risk management. In contrast, a Cybersecurity Analyst often operates within an organization's security team, concentrating on threat detection and incident response.

MANTECH seeks a motivated, career and customer-oriented Information Assurance Engineer to join our team in Crane, Indiana. This is an onsite position.
As a core member, you will assist in the research & design, engineering, integration, testing, training, logistics, laboratory research, field engineering, and acquisition and operations analysis in support of a variety of Navy and Marine Corps programs and projects with a focus on defensive cyber technologies, mission assurance, and resilience capabilities for the tactical network environment. Your effort will go towards dramatically increasing the warfighter's effectiveness. If you enjoy working on a highly collaborative and dynamic team and want to make a difference for the warfighter, then we would love to have you on our team!
Responsibilities include but not limited to:
  • Establishes and satisfies complex system-wide information security requirements based upon the analysis of user, policy, regulatory, and resource demands
  • Supports customers at the highest levels in the development and implementation of doctrine and policies
  • Applies expertise to government and commercial common user systems, as well as to dedicated special purpose systems requiring specialized security features and procedures
  • Examples could include command and control-related network
  • Provide technical support in investigating and minimizing real or potential damage resulting from security incidents
  • Research, analyze, integrate, and distribute IS security tools and associated documentation, subject to government review and approval
  • Provide on-site assistance for integrating IS security tools into contractor and Government information systems
  • Develop and propose security procedures for systems and software within area of expertise to ensure consistent security policy implementation for review and approval by the Government

Minimum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in any discipline, or a High School Diploma and 11+ years of relevant experience, or an Associate's Degree and 8+ years of relevant experience may be substituted in lieu of Bachelor's degree
  • 5+ years of experience in Information Engineering, Security or a related field
  • Experience in computer systems, networks, and security principles
  • Experience presenting technical information clearly and concisely to both technical and non-technical audiences
  • Experience analyzing security risks and vulnerabilities

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Master's Degree
  • Experience utilizing assessment tools (e.g., ACAS, SCAP, HBSS) and RMF process tools (e.g., MCCAST, eMASS, eArcher, VRAM and DITPR-DON/DADMS) preferred
  • Cybersecurity Workforce (CSWF) training with current baseline certifications such as: CompTia, Sec+, CISSP, or equivalent

Clearance Requirements:
  • Must have a current or active Secret Clearance with the ability to obtain up to a TS/SCI clearance
